How to say "rainy" in Japanese
雨のあめの · ame no
"Rainy" in Japanese is 雨の (ame no), as in 雨の日 (a rainy day). A rainy season or place is described with 雨が多い.

Ways to say "rainy" in Japanese
| Japanese | When to use it |
|---|---|
| 雨のあめの · ame no | Rainy (describing a day). |
| 雨の日あめのひ · ame no hi | Rainy day. |
| 雨が多いあめがおおい · ame ga ōi | Rainy (having a lot of rain). |
How to use it
"Rainy season" is 梅雨 (tsuyu) in Japan.
Umbrellas for sale appear at every convenience store on rainy days.
Example sentences
- 雨の日は家にいます。Ame no hi wa ie ni imasu.I stay home on rainy days.
- 六月は雨が多いです。Rokugatsu wa ame ga ōi desu.June is rainy.
- 雨の日は電車が混みます。Ame no hi wa densha ga komimasu.Trains are crowded on rainy days.
- 雨の日でも楽しめる場所はありますか。Ame no hi demo tanoshimeru basho wa arimasu ka.Are there places to enjoy even on a rainy day?
- 雨の週末でした。Ame no shūmatsu deshita.It was a rainy weekend.
- この地域は雨が多いです。Kono chiiki wa ame ga ōi desu.This region is rainy.

Questions
How do you say "rainy day" in Japanese?
Say 雨の日 (ame no hi).
How do you say "save for a rainy day" in Japanese?
A similar idea is もしものために貯金する (moshimo no tame ni chokin suru), "save money just in case."
